Output 908f6c83d69c15ddb204a15fca317b0d95fec67923e2f1df1b763a380e4c5dc0:1

value
2385362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b4ca6d453ba1bd19139b36893f2b6acb439ffe4 OP_EQUAL
address
32imBWHmCF5nUcQoVu1yXV7LWGKCJpqDoN
transaction
908f6c83d69c15ddb204a15fca317b0d95fec67923e2f1df1b763a380e4c5dc0
confirmations
117554
spent
true